Transaction 17c475c4806138ce417c90d24dadf3c58549e79fb03f85b20ea734190a7d8cc0

1 Input
2 Outputs
  • 17c475c4806138ce417c90d24dadf3c58549e79fb03f85b20ea734190a7d8cc0:0
  • value  1000000
    address  3Bp9z6SfUbVUAkG6LMMoPmUs6SLoKQqsFT
  • 17c475c4806138ce417c90d24dadf3c58549e79fb03f85b20ea734190a7d8cc0:1
  • value  25615956
    address  3HTcJZNEYCrXG9LqCv7qnStLthWU4MDeFA